Treats each Markdown file as a single long example, which continues across multiple Markdown fenced code blocks (FCBs or blocks).

- Checks either Python code examples or ">>>" REPL examples | doctest.
- Reports pass/failed/error/skip status and Markdown file line number for each block.
- Shows block source indicating the line where the exception propagated.
- Support for setup and cleanup. Acquire and release resources, change context, Pass objects as global variables to the examples. Cleans up even when fail-fast. Suite initialization and cleanup
- Call from Python, call from pytest.
- Write a pytest testfile into an existing pytest or unittest test suite.
- Runs files in user specified order.
- TOML configuration available.
- An example can continue across files.
- Show stdout printed by examples. --stdout
- Colors pass/failed/error/skip status. --color
- Syntax highlights broken FCBs in the log. --style
- Check expected output of code examples. Markdown edits are required.
- Designated and stable patch points for Python standard library unittest.mock.patch() patches. | Here

python -m pip install phmutest
- No required dependencies since Python 3.11. Depends on tomli before Python 3.11.
- Pure Python.
- It is advisable to install in a virtual environment.
The extra 'color' enables the --color and --style options.
python -m pip install "phmutest[color]" # Windows
python -m pip install 'phmutest[color]' # Unix/macOS
The extra 'pytest' installs pytest and the plugin pytest-subtests. pytest-subtests continues running subtests after the first subtest failure. pytest prints a very helpful traceback when FCBs break.
python -m pip install "phmutest[pytest]" # Windows
python -m pip install 'phmutest[pytest]' # Unix/macOS
The extra 'traceback' enables stackprinter traceback printing for each broken FCB. The traceback is slightly different than pytest's.
python -m pip install "phmutest[traceback]" # Windows
python -m pip install 'phmutest[traceback]' # Unix/macOS
Install with the extra 'dev' to install locally the same tools used by the continuous integration scripts.
python -m pip install "phmutest[dev]" # Windows
python -m pip install 'phmutest[dev]' # Unix/macOS
Install with all the extras.
python -m pip install "phmutest[color, traceback, dev]" # Windows
python -m pip install 'phmutest[color, traceback, dev]' # Unix/macOS

- The -f option indicates fail fast.
The Markdown files are processed in the same order they are present as positional arguments on the command line. Shell wildcards can be used. Be aware that the shell expansion and operating system will determine the order.
When --replmode is specified Python interactive sessions are tested and Python code and expected output blocks are not tested. REPL mode tests are implemented using doctest. The option --setup-across-files and the setup and teardown directives have no effect in REPL mode. --progress has file by file granularity. See the Broken REPL example.
For background refer to definitions at the top of unittest. Use --fixture to specify a Python initialization function that runs before the tests. It works with or without --replmode, but there are differences. In both modes, the fixture function may create objects (globs) that are visible as globals to the FCBs under test.
In the event of test errors orderly cleanup/release of resources is assured. For Python code blocks the fixture may register cleanup functions by calling unittest.addModuleCleanup(). In REPL mode the fixture function optionally returns a cleanup function.
- The fixture can acquire and release resources or change context.
- The fixture can make entries to the log displayed by --log.
- The fixture can install patches to the code under test.
Specify the --fixture function as
a relative dotted path where /
is replaced with .
.
For example, the function my_init() in the file tests/myfixture.py
would be specified:
--fixture tests.myfixture.my_init
The function is passed keyword only arguments and optionally returns a Fixture instance. The keyword arguments and return type are described by src/phmutest/fixture.py. The fixture file should be in the project directory tree. Fixture demos:
The test case test_doctest_optionflags_patch() shows an example with a fixture that applies a patch to doctest optionflags in --replmode.
The fixture function must be at the top level of a .py file.
- The dotted_path has components separated by ".".
- The last component is the function name.
- The next to last component is the python file name without the .py suffix.
- The preceding components identify parent folders. Folders should be relative to the current working directory which is typically the project root.

Names assigned by all the blocks in a file can be shared, as global variables, to files specified later in the command line. Add a markdown file path to the --share-across-files command line option. The 'shared' file(s) must also be specified as a FILE positional command line argument.
The skip --skip TEXT
command line option
prevents testing of any Python code or REPL block that contains the substring TEXT.
The block is logged as skip with --skip TEXT
as the reason.

Command line options can be augmented with values from a [tool.phmutest]
section in
a .toml configuration file. It can be in a new file or added to an existing
.toml file like pyproject.toml.
The configuration file is specified by the --config FILE
command line option.
Zero or more of these TOML keys may be present in the [tool.phmutest]
section.
TOML key | Usage option | TOML value - double quoted strings |
---|---|---|
include-globs | positional arg FILE | list of filename glob to select files |
exclude-globs | positional arg FILE | list of filename glob to deselect files |
share-across-files | --share-across-files | list of path |
setup-across-files | --setup-across-files | list of path |
fixture | --fixture | dotted path |
select | --select | list of group directive name |
deselect | --deselect | list of group directive name |
color | --color | Use unquoted true to set |
style | --style | set Pygments syntax highlighting style |
Only one of select and deselect can have strings.
- globs are described by Python standard library pathlib.Path.glob().
- Any FILEs on the command line extend the files selected by include-globs and exclude-globs.
- Command line options supersede the keys in the config file.
- See the example tests/toml/project.toml.

In some of the tests the --fixture function is in the same pytest file as the phmutest library call. This is not recommended because the Python file is imported again by fixture_function_importer() to a new module object. The Python file's module level code will be run a second time. If there are side-effects they will be repeated, likely with un-desirable and hard to troubleshoot behavior.
Feel free to unittest.mock.patch() at these places in the code and not worry about breakage in future versions. Look for examples in tests/test_patching.py.
patched function | purpose |
---|---|
phmutest.direct.directive_finders() | Add directive aliases |
phmutest.fenced.python_matcher() | Add detect Python from FCB info string |
phmutest.select.OUTPUT_INFO_STRINGS | Change detect expected output FCB info string |
phmutest.session.modify_docstring() | Inspect/modify REPL text before testing |
phmutest.reader.post() | Inspect/modify DocNode detected in Markdown |

- phmutest treats each Markdown file as a single long example. phmdoctest tests each FCB in isolation. Adding a share-names directive is necessary to extend an example across FCBs within a file.
- Only phmutest can extend an example across files.
- phmutest uses Python standard library unittest and doctest as test runners. phmdoctest writes a pytest testfile for each Markdown file which requires a separate step to run. The testfiles then need to be discarded.
- phmdoctest offers two pytest fixtures that can be used in a pytest test case to generate and run a testfile in one step.
- phmutest generates tests for multiple Markdown files in one step and runs them internally so there are no leftover test files.
- The --fixture test suite initialization and cleanup is only available on phmutest. phmdoctest offers some initialization behavior using an FCB with a setup directive and its --setup-doctest option and it only works with sessions. See phmdoctest documentation "Execution Context" section for an explanation.
- phmutest does not support inline annotations.
